TODAY IN MINNESOTA: 1820-Captain Stephen Kearny's expedition to find a road from Council Bluffs, Iowa, to Fort St. Anthony (later Snelling) arrives at Lake Pepin, having lost their way. Kearny then marches his men north to the fort. (MN. Historical Society http://events.mnhs.org/bookofdays/)
